The price of scooters is determined depending on the model and features. The cheapest travel scooters have a compact and lightweight design. They can be folded for easy transport. They usually have a smaller turning radius and narrow base but can still handle moderate outdoor terrain. Other scooters are built for use over a longer period of time, and feature larger motors, a longer base and larger tires. These models are made to accommodate heavier riders and come with a variety of accessories, such as arm rests and storage baskets as well as swinging chairs and more.
Scooter specifications that you should consider include the capacity for weight, maximum speed and travel range of the scooter. The dimensions and style of the rear and front tires are also important considerations because they affect the vehicle's handling and maneuverability. Some models feature suspension for a smoother ride as well as a battery that recharges faster than other models to allow longer trips.
Another important aspect to consider is the height clearance of the unit. The scooter must be capable of safely navigating curbs, ramps and other obstacles that are frequent in towns and cities. Also the ability to climb hills and other steep grades is a must for a lot of users.
The amount of storage space on a scooter is a final aspect to consider. It is essential to have enough space for a bag or groceries. Some scooters have hidden storage beneath the seat or on the tiller, while others have several storage compartments such as baskets, underarm bags and even a saddlebag in the rear of the scooter.
If someone is planning to use their scooter in public areas, it's crucial to choose a scooter with safety features including headlights, indicator lights along with a horn and rear view mirror. A padded, comfortable seat and armrest are also desirable. Many scooters have the option of locking storage that can be removed for personal items.

Benefits of Online Dealers
Shopping online for scooters has a lot of advantages over local stores. First, the selection of products is much greater. The majority of online sellers sell every model made by their manufacturer, and almost always at MAP prices determined by the manufacturer. If you notice a scooter being sold at a lower price the dealer may be in violation of the MAP (minimum advertised price) and may lose their contract with the manufacturer.
Another benefit is the knowledge offered by the sales staff. Many online dealers employ sales representatives who can answer customer questions and assist customers in choosing the best scooter for their requirements. They can also provide tips and suggestions on how to keep the scooter running smoothly. Additionally, online retailers typically cost less for shipping and handling than local retailers.
The type of scooter you pick will depend on the location you plan to use it and how often. For instance, if require a ride on uneven surfaces or through an area that is crowded, you'll require an electric scooter with greater ground clearance and is able to carry more weight. Also, if you will be taking the scooter for long distances, it is important to know how long the battery can run before it's time to recharge.
There are many different scooter models to choose from, including folding, travel and full-size scooters. Folding and travel scooters are lighter and smaller than full-size models, making them easier to fit into trunks or lifts for vehicles that have suitable attachment points. They also tend to offer better specifications such as longer travel ranges and faster top speeds than their larger counterparts.
Full-size scooters tend to be more expensive than their smaller counterparts and are designed to provide the right balance of convenience, value and performance. They're not as compact as folding or travel models, but they come with more roomy seats and features that make them more convenient to use for longer trips. Wider bases, a more comfortable suspension, and other accessories such as lighted rearview mirrors and headlights are all included.
Recreational scooters mobility for sale aren't intended to replace medical scooters, but are a great alternative for people who require assistance walking and would like a more enjoyable way to get around. They have a higher top speed than medical scooters in general and are a good choice for those who don't need to travel long distances or travel through dense areas.
When buying a scooter, ensure it comes with warranties to guard against any issues that may occur over time. The majority of online sellers provide warranties that cover both parts and labor. The warranty period differs between dealers, but most offer an initial one-year warranty and an maximum of three years.
Many online retailers offer scooter maintenance at home to make the process simpler. This service is beneficial for those who are unable repair your scooter on your own. If you choose to avail this option, the company will send a technician out to your house to repair or replace your scooter's damaged part.
